Multiple AC units
There are various configuration options to control multiple ducted AC units from a single wall controller. The following diagrams illustrate the wiring required for these configurations, each showing three ducted AC units connected to a primary wall controller, with an optional secondary wall controller.
Nexus wall controller
Each ducted AC unit is each connected to its own CPU Module (C225), which provides the communication link between each indoor unit and the wall controller. The CPU Modules (C225) are then all wired back to a central Net Mutiplexer (CISM) that manages communication between the multiple AC units and the control interface. The Multiplexer connects to a Nexus+ wall controller (CCTSLW+), allowing a single touchscreen to control and monitor all three systems, with an additional optional wall controller shown for secondary access.
Each Multiplexer is powered seperately with a 24VAC power supply (CT24ACE). The Multiplexer can display up to 5 indoor units and a maximum of 3 Nexus wall controllers can be connected.

Nova DC wall controller
Every Smart Hub (COCBH) is connected to a CPU Module (C225) on a one-to-one basis, meaning one hub is required for each CPU module. The Smart Hub communictes with the CPU Module via an iZone proprietary radio frequency (RF) protocol. Each Smart Hub connects to the local Wi-Fi network via a router, enabling network communication across all systems.
The Nova DC wall controller (CCASLW) then connects to the same Wi-Fi network and automatically discovers all Smart Hubs present, displaying each connected system on the home screen for selection and control. Additional Nova DC wall controllers can be added to the network (up to six in total), allowing multiple control points for the connected AC systems.

Nova CAT wall controller
A Screen Link Multiplexer (CSLM) is used when connecting one or more Nova CAT wall controllers (CCASLWE) to a Screen Link Module (CSL), providing a centralised communication interface between multiple ducted AC systems and the wall controllers. The Multiplexer manages data distribution across connected systems, enabling coordinated control and system selection from a single interface.
Each Multiplexer requires a dedicated 24VAC power supply (CT24ACE) for operation. A single Multiplexer supports up to four indoor units, with a maximum of two Nova CAT wall controllers connected per CSLM.
